搜索到与相关的文章
编程技术

Struts 1.2 控制器原理

Struts1.2依然是应用很广的框架,熟悉其基本的控制流程是必要的:一、ActionServlet的初始化ActionServlet作为Struts组件的前端控制器,由于web.xml的相应配置:0在应用一加载时即会被实例化并调用其init方法,init方法所做的主要工作有二:加载struts配置文件,并创建用于封装配置信息的ModuleCo

系统 2019-08-29 22:24:55 2570

编程技术

Spring Security3

使用SpringSecurity3的四种方法概述那么在SpringSecurity3的使用中,有4种方法:一种是全部利用配置文件,将用户、权限、资源(url)硬编码在xml文件中,已经实现过,并经过验证;二种是用户和权限用数据库存储,而资源(url)和权限的对应采用硬编码配置,目前这种方式已经实现,并经过验证。三种是细分角色和权限,并将用户、角色、权限和资源均采用数据库存储,并且自定义过滤器,代替原有的FilterSecurityInterceptor过滤

系统 2019-08-29 22:19:07 2570

编程技术

看图测性格

1.无忧无虑,顽皮,愉快的人你喜欢自由自在,无拘无束的生活。你的座右铭是:生命只能活一次,因此你尽量享受每一刻。你好奇心旺盛,对新事物抱有开放的态度;你向往改变,讨厌束缚。你觉得身边的环境都不断在变,而且经常为你带来惊喜。2.独立,前卫,不受拘束你追求自由及不受拘束,自我的生活。你的工作及消闲活动都与艺术有关。你对于自由的渴求有时候会使你做出令人出人意表的事。你的生活方式极具个人色彩;你永远不会盲目追逐潮流。相反地,你会根据自己的意思和信念去生活,就算是逆

系统 2019-08-29 22:12:25 2570

编程技术

Spring MVC测试框架详解——服务端测试

随着RESTfulWebService的流行,测试对外的Service是否满足期望也变的必要的。从Spring3.2开始Spring了SpringWeb测试框架,如果版本低于3.2,请使用spring-test-mvc项目(合并到spring3.2中了)。SpringMVC测试框架提供了对服务器端和客户端(基于RestTemplate的客户端)提供了支持。对于服务器端:在Spring3.2之前,我们测试时一般都是直接new控制器,注入依赖,然后判断返回值。

系统 2019-08-29 22:02:21 2570

编程技术

安装VisualSVN Server过程中出现错误,无法启动

安装VisualSVNServer过程中出现错误,无法启动VisualSVN服务OS为WINDOWS2008,干净系统,只有iis和ftp服务,安装到最后一步出错,提示为VisualSVB服务无法启动,查看日志,提示:“Product:VisualSVNServer2.1.1--Error1920.Service'VisualSVNServer'failedtostart.PleasecheckVisualSVNServerloginEventViewer

系统 2019-08-29 22:01:15 2570

编程技术

设计模式之工厂模式Factory

工厂模式:主要用来实例化有共同接口的类,工厂模式可以动态决定应该实例化那一个类。工厂模式主要用以下几种形态:简单工厂(SimpleFactory),工厂方法(FactoryMethod),抽象工厂(AbstractFactory)1.简单工厂模式(SimpleFactory)简单工厂又叫静态工厂,是工厂模式三中状态中结构最为简单的它主要有一个静态方法,用来接受参数,并根据参数来决定返回实现同一接口的不同类的实例。我们来看一个具体的例子:假设一家工厂,几生产

系统 2019-08-29 21:55:36 2570

各行各业

HDU 1704 Rank (传递闭包)

题目:http://acm.hdu.edu.cn/showproblem.php?pid=1704题意:最多能找出多少条不通的路。。。。。题目没有说明不会有回路,因为如果有回路的话,回路里的对手都不能分出胜负。。。。而杭电的数据说明了不会有回路的。传递闭包:用来求图中,任意两点是否可以通,思想类似Floyed,都是3重循环,Floyed:是否存在一个中间点,使得从起点——》中间点——》终点跟短,传递闭包:是否存在一个中间点,起点到终点本来不通的,但从起点—

系统 2019-08-12 09:26:53 2570

MySql

怎样在本地电脑上连接另外一台电脑上的mysql数

基本上有两种方式:1,使用MYSQL的管理工具,可以远程连接,比如用导航猫系列的,只要知道对方IP,然后就可以自己输入账号密码连接了。2,使用代码连接。Java代码示例:packagecom.test;importjava.sql.Connection;importjava.sql.DriverManager;importjava.sql.ResultSet;importjava.sql.Statement;publicclassDataBaseTest{

系统 2019-08-12 01:54:15 2570

数据库相关

游标sql语句

declarecursoremp_cursor(pnoinnumberdefault7369)isselect*fromempwhereempno=pno;emp_rowemp%rowtype;beginopenemp_cursor(7934);fetchemp_cursorintoemp_row;dbms_output.put_line(emp_row.ename);closeemp_cursor;end;/declarecursoremp_cursor

系统 2019-08-12 01:53:34 2570

Tomcat

Tomcat安装、配置和部署笔记

首先从Apache的官方网站(http://tomcat.apache.org/)下载Tomcat。有安装版和解压版两种,我个人喜欢用解压版。Tomcat安装(绿色版安装)1、将下载的Tomcat解压到指定目录,如:D:\WorkSpaceByJava\DevtTools\Apache-Tomcat-8.0.232、Tomcat的目录结构bin:目录存放一些启动运行Tomcat的可执行程序和相关内容。conf:存放关于Tomcat服务器的全局配置。lib:

系统 2019-08-12 01:33:45 2570